Where is the Cotet family from?

You can see how Cotet families moved over time by selecting different census years. The Cotet family name was found in the USA between 1880 and 1920. The most Cotet families were found in USA in 1880. In 1880 there were 5 Cotet families living in Ohio. This was 100% of all the recorded Cotet's in USA. Ohio had the highest population of Cotet families in 1880.
